I received my swayde () shifter the other day from Luke. Put it on a few hours ago. As Stuckey said, very simple install. The only thing that is really needed to be done is the shifter stalk must be removed from the V2 leather boot and put on the V1 leather boot. No point in making a redundant how-to because Stuckey's was point on, for an already simple install. Just peel back the leather a bit and it pops right off, no problem. Here are a few pics I snapped with bad lighting from my garage (it's raining here in NJ).








...
...
...
I forgot to take a before picture, so the closest thing I could find was this picture after installing Heavy's Fire Extinguisher mount which kind of shows the factory shifter.




And after.....




Overall, very happy with how it came out. I think it's safe to say it's pretty much identical to the stock shifter as far as weight goes, but it feels very nice in your hand. Also, I know a lot of guys were worried about whether the shifter would match the interior nicely. Turns out it is spot on with the swayde inserts. All in all it's a great mod...it really looks great and the car should have came from the factory with it. Great idea Stuckey I know Luke said he only had 10 or so in stock before back order and I can think of 3 or 4 of them that are already gone (to friends of mine), so if you want one, I suggest calling soon. Hope this helps anyone on the fence.
